Breaking Down the Quarterback Market
The five categories identified by Sports Illustrated include established starters, high-upside prospects, consolation veterans, and others. Observers point out that each category presents unique opportunities and challenges for teams. Established starters, for instance, offer stability and consistency, while high-upside prospects bring potential for growth and improvement. Consolation veterans, on the other hand, may provide temporary solutions or serve as mentors for younger players.
